LC-MS/MS法同时测定穿心莲中6种农药残留量

本研究旨在建立测定穿心莲中6种农药残留量的方法,更好地控制药材质量.研究通过高效液相色谱-串联四极杆质谱仪以多反应监测(MRNI)的扫描模式对空白、样品和对照品进行测试,采用ACQUITYUPLCBEHC18柱分离,高效液相色谱-串联质谱联用方法测定穿心莲中常用的6种农药残留量.结果表明:该方法下霜脲氰、敌敌畏、2,4-滴、精喹禾灵、毒死蜱和氯氰菊酯的检测限分别为0.015 mg/kg、0.125 mg/kg、0.04 mg/kg、0.01 mg/kg、0.03 mg/kg、0.025 mg/kg,在一定浓度范围内,响应值与质量浓度的线性关系良好(r>0.990),6种目标物对照品溶液及样品加标溶液在仪器参数波动时结果RSD均小于10%.室温下,6种目标物对照品溶液及样品加标溶液在14h内峰面积RSD均小于5%,在14h内溶液稳定.20批穿心莲样品检测结果:仅其中1批检出氯氰菊酯41.2ng/g,其余样品均未检出,符合要求.本研究方法简便,线性、耐用性良好,能满足同时测定6种农药在穿心莲中的残留量.
Simultaneous Determination of 6 Pesticide Residues in Andrographis paniculata by LC-MS/MS
The aim of this study was to establish a method for the determination of 6 pesticide residues in Andrographis paniculata,so as to better control the quality of the medicinal materials.A high-performance liquid chromatography-tandem quadrupole mass spectrometer was used to test blank,sample and control samples in the scanning mode of multi-reaction monitoring(MRNI).ACQUITY UPLC BEH C18 column was used for separation,and high performance liquid chromatography-tandem mass spectrometry was used to determine the 6 pes-ticide residues commonly used in Andrographis paniculata.The results showed that the detection limits of cypermethrin,dichlorvos,2,4-drops,glyphosate,chlorpyrifos,and cypermethrin under this method were 0.015 mg/kg,0.125 mg/kg,0.04 mg/kg,0.01 mg/kg,0.03 mg/kg,and 0.025 mg/kg,respectively.Within a certain concentration range,the response values had a good linear relationship with the mass con-centration(r>0.990),and the RSD of the six target substance reference solutions and sample spiked solutions were all less than 10%when the instrument parameters fluctuated.At room temperature,the RSD of the peak area of the six target reference solution and sample spiking solution was less than 5%within 14 hours,and the solution remained stable within 14 h.The test results of 20 batches of Andrographispan-iculata samples showed that only one batch detected 41.2 ng/g of cypermethrin,while the remaining samples were not detected,meeting the requirements.This research method is simple,linear and durable,and can be used to determine the residues of six pesticides in Andrographis paniculata at the same time.
